I was just pointing out if u use the net like I do then using a cell phone connection is extremely expensive - Dutch_12078Explorer IIIWe currently use an AT&T/Cricket hotspot with unlimited 4G/LTE data and a Verizon hotspot with unlimited 3G data. We also have another Verizon hotpot with a 20GB/mo 4G/LTE plan, but I currently have it suspended since the AT&T service has been very good wherever we've been recently.
- stickdogExplorerWe've been running Verizon Mifi for 4 years. It has been reliable we try to use campground wifi when available which most isn't. We presently have 4 devices connected two laptops and two samsung tablets and Dw's phone on the same plan 24 gigs unlimited voice and message , good in Canada for $140.00 plus tax and fees.
